CelloFest Houston 2025 Final Concert

Tuesday, February 25, 2025

7:30 pm - 9:00 pm

The grand finale of CelloFest is here! Join us for a stunning evening showcasing the incredible talent of CelloFest participants and faculty. From solo performances to breathtaking ensemble pieces, this concert promises to be a celebration of music, artistry, and the passion of the cello.
